Hit 125 down today!!! At "first" goal weight...!! (Probably want to drop another 20 or so and then work back up 10 but I'll figure that out later...)

Really just started stalling for the very first time this week. Have consistently dropped between 4 and 5 pounds EVERY week since I started weighing (two weeks after surgery.)

I remember reading all the posts of everyone who were 3 and 4 months into the surgery and thinking, "Really? They really don't still fixate on food?" Well, you know what? You really don't... It's amazing to me how much "routine" everything just becomes.

Do I still crave things...? Of course, but a lot less often and it doesn't take ANYWHERE as much willpower to keep them in perspective.
